The partnership between Limpopo Department of Cooperative Government, Human Settlements and Traditional Affairs (CoGHSTA) and SABC Combo is surely bearing tangible fruits in the lives of the needy communities of Limpopo. Last Friday, November 11, 2011, the department led by the SABC Regional Manager, Mr Victor Ravhuanzwo handed over a fully furnished modern six-bedroomed house to the family of Mr Melton Shabangu and Mrs Jane Nkosi of Kotsiri village, Sekhukhune District. This is the family that recently made headlines, with 23 (twenty three) dependants, six of which are no longer living, and 17 alive and only have social grants as a means for survival. The eldest son, Moses was born in 1979 and is unemployed, and the only hope for the family, is 27 yrs old Joel who holds a matric certificate and the hope that one day his family situation will change for the better as he recently received a bursary to study Social Auxiliary Services.
Speaking during the actual handing over ceremony, Cllr. David Magabo, Executive Mayor of Sekhukhune District Municipality, urged community development workers and everyone to work hand in clove to identify families with similar situations, as government will continue to provide necessary facilities its people. For this financial year, the department has changed lives of fives needy families in the province through the Celebrity Build programme.
The family was delighted to receive such a big house, where in his words Mr Melton Shabangu said “I would like to thank Government, contractor (NATMAB Construction & Project Managers), stakeholders including Jane-Furse furniture, and everyone who contributed in changing my life and my big family. We’ve been suffering for quite a long time. May the good Lord bless them” he concluded.
